will.i.am.Performs With University of Wisconsin Marching Band, Partners With Ultrabook [Video]

 

will.i.am recently joined the University of Wisconsin marching band at LA Live in Los Angeles for a performance of his new song “Great Times.”

The celebration was part of the pep rallies for the 2012 Rose Bowl game between Wisconsin and Oregon, as well as the iamFIRST initiative to create awareness for will.i.am’s efforts with education.

The 301 person marching band, led by Professor Michael Leckrone, chose “Great Times” for its fitting lyrics and energy. The track is the Brazilian promo single for will.i.am’s upcoming solo album, #WILLPOWER, which is due out soon.

will.i.am is also working with Ultrabook, an ultra portable laptop computer, as part of The Ultrabook Project. Using only his eyes, ears, and his Ultrabook, will.i.am will travel around the globe, writing and recording one new song inspired by each city he visits.
